Suspicious packet creates panic,delays New Delhi-bound SpiceJet flight

Police took into custody two employees of the courier company.

A packet,suspected to be carrying explosives,recovered from the cargo section of a Guwahati-New Delhi SpiceJet aircraft,today created panic and delayed the flight at the Lokopriyo Gopinath Bordoloi International Airport at Borjhar here,police said.

Cargo handlers of SG-881,scheduled to leave here at 3:30 PM,found a suspicious-looking packet with wires and informed the CISF personnel posted at the airport who in turn handed over the packet to the police.

The police immediately informed forensic experts who rushed to the spot to examine the packet which was booked by a person from Meghalaya with a courier company and was being sent to a person in New Delhi.

On preliminary investigations,the forensic experts said that the materials were not explosives but were used in heaters for sealing purpose.

They took away the materials for further investigations in their laboratory.

Meanwhile,the police took into custody two employees of the courier company and the flight later left for its onward journey,the police added.
